Pineapple Apricot Bellini

Pineapple juice mixed with apricot nectar and sparkling wine. Use sparkling cider for a nonalcoholic version!
Prep Time5 minutes mins
Total Time5 minutes mins
Servings: 4 servings
Author: Nikki Gladd

Ingredients

  • 1 cup sparkling white wine or sparkling cider
  • ½ cup DOLE® Pineapple Juice
  • ½ cup apricot nectar

Instructions

  • Stir all of the ingredients in a large pitcher. Pour into champagne flutes and serve.
